How AI Enhances Financial Calculations
Traditional financial calculators rely on fixed assumptions and linear projections. AI-powered tools, however, incorporate:
- Machine Learning Algorithms: Analyze historical data to identify patterns and predict future trends with higher accuracy
- Natural Language Processing: Interpret financial documents and news to adjust projections in real-time
- Monte Carlo Simulations: Run thousands of scenarios to provide probability-based outcomes rather than single-point estimates
- Behavioral Analysis: Adjust recommendations based on user behavior patterns and risk tolerance
- Alternative Data Integration: Incorporate non-traditional data sources like satellite imagery or social media sentiment

How to Evaluate AI Financial Calculators
When selecting an AI financial calculator, consider these key factors:
- Data Sources: Does it incorporate real-time market data and alternative data sources?
- Model Transparency: Can the AI explain its recommendations in understandable terms?
- Customization: Can it adapt to your specific financial situation and goals?
- Security: Does it use enterprise-grade encryption and data protection?
- Regulatory Compliance: Is it certified by relevant financial authorities?
- Performance Tracking: Can it show how its recommendations have performed historically?
- Integration: Does it connect with your existing financial accounts and tools?
- Cost: Is the pricing structure transparent and reasonable for the value provided?

Ethical Considerations in AI Financial Advice
As AI becomes more prevalent in financial decision-making, several ethical concerns have emerged:
-
Algorithmic Bias:
AI models trained on historical data may perpetuate existing financial biases. A 2021 study found that some AI loan approval systems were 40% more likely to reject applications from minority neighborhoods, even when controlling for financial factors.
-
Over-reliance on AI:
There’s a risk that users may follow AI recommendations without understanding the underlying logic. Financial regulators are increasingly requiring “explainability” features in AI financial tools.
-
Data Privacy:
AI financial tools require access to sensitive financial data. Ensuring proper data protection and user consent is paramount.
-
Accountability:
When AI recommendations lead to poor financial outcomes, determining responsibility becomes complex.
To address these concerns, leading financial institutions are adopting AI ethics frameworks that include:
- Regular bias audits of AI models
- Clear disclosure of AI limitations
- Human-in-the-loop review for critical decisions
- Transparent data usage policies
- Third-party validation of AI models
